资料已经打包好了,需要的公众号发送“11”领取
很多人想学 Python,却总在第一步就卡壳:到底该从哪开始?今天就把亲测有效的自学顺序分享出来,照着走,零基础也能少走半年弯路!
第一阶段:把基础砸实(1-2 周)
先花10天左右啃透这 3 个核心:
火语法入门:变量、数据类型、条件判断、循环语句。推荐用 “边敲边记” 法,每个语法点至少敲5遍。
火函数与模块:学会定义函数、传参、返回值,再搞懂怎么调用Python自带的模块、这步就像学搭积木,练熟了才能快速拼出复杂程序。
火文件操作:掌握打开、读取、写入txt/csv文件的方法。
第二阶段:做迷你项目练手(2-3 周)
基础打牢后,必须用小项目巩固,从这 3 类入手:
火自动化工具:写个 “批量重命名文件” 的脚本,或者用 xlrd 库处理 Excel 表格,把重复工作交给代码。
火简易游戏:用 Pygame 库做 “猜数字”“贪吃蛇” 小游戏,不用太复杂。游戏开发最能练逻辑,玩着玩着就把知识吃透了。
火数据爬取:爬点简单数据,比如豆瓣图书的评分、天气预报信息。
第三阶段:瞄准方向深耕(1-2 个月)
Python应用方向很多,选一个深耕效率更高:
火数据分析:学Pandas处理数据,Matplotlib/Seaborn 画图,能做销售报表、用户画像分析,适合职场人提升竞争力。
火Web开发:用Flask/Django搭简易网站,比如个人博客、在线表单,想转行程序员的可以往这走。
火人工智能:先学NumPy做数学计算,再入门Scikit-learn库,从简单的线性回归预测开始,慢慢过渡到图像识别、文本分析。
⚠️避坑指南:这些错误别犯!
禁别死磕理论!看懂不如敲懂,敲懂不如用懂,遇到报错先自己查原因,比直接问人印象深 10 倍。
禁别贪多求快!每天学2小时比周末突击 10 小时效果好,保持手感很重要。
有选对教材很关键!推荐清华大学出版的《Python趣味编程:从入门到人工智能》,章节顺序和自学节奏高度匹配,每个阶段都有对应项目,新手跟着练准没错。
按这个步骤走,你会发现编程真的没那么难~
#计算机专业 #Python #编程 #Python入门 #Python学习 #IT #程序员 #编程学习 #大学生 #Python自学